MUMBAI, India, March 13 -- Intellectual Property India has published a patent application (202621004290 A) filed by Vishwakarma Institute Of Technology, Pune, Maharashtra, on Jan. 16, for 'a vehicle speed control system.'

Inventor(s) include Mundada, Kapil; Mundada, Dipali; Patwal, Pradyot Sanjeev; Pendor, Harshal Pola; Pawar, Harish Subhash; and Pisal, Yashraj Bhausaheb.

The application for the patent was published on March 13, under issue no. 11/2026.

According to the abstract released by the Intellectual Property India: "The present invention is related to a vehicle speed control system that combines real-time image processing, optical character recognition [OCR], and sensor-based feedback to enhance road safety. An ESP32-CAM module (...
